The Lens Replacement Process

Refractive Lens Exchange (RLE), or lens replacement surgery, involves replacing the eye's natural lens with an artificial intraocular lens (IOL). This procedure is not just for individuals with cataracts; it's also a viable option for those seeking vision correction and freedom from glasses or contact lenses. The surgery addresses refractive errors like nearsightedness, farsightedness, and astigmatism.

The process begins with a thorough evaluation to determine the most suitable IOL for the patient's unique needs. In the operating room, the natural lens is delicately replaced with the chosen artificial lens, offering tailored vision correction for clear and precise eyesight. Lens replacement surgery mainly benefits individuals over 40 experiencing age-related vision changes, providing a long-term solution for refractive errors. The Lasik Process

LASIK, or Laser-Assisted In Situ Keratomileusis, is a precise refractive surgery designed to correct common vision issues like myopia, hyperopia, and astigmatism. In the procedure, a thin corneal flap is created, revealing the underlying tissue. A specialized laser then sculpts the cornea to reshape it, improving how light is focused onto the retina. The flap is carefully repositioned, acting as a natural bandage for rapid healing. Known for its quick recovery, LASIK has become a transformative solution, providing many individuals with clearer vision without dependence on glasses or contact lenses.

The PRK Process

Photorefractive Keratectomy (PRK) is a laser eye surgery that corrects refractive errors like myopia, hyperopia, and astigmatism. Unlike LASIK, PRK involves directly shaping the cornea without creating a flap. The procedure starts by removing the outer layer of the cornea and exposing the underlying tissue for precise laser reshaping. Although the recovery period is slightly longer than LASIK due to epithelial regeneration, PRK is renowned for its effectiveness in achieving clear vision without needing a corneal flap. Lens Replacement vs. LASIK and PRK

  1. Scope of Correction
    Lens replacement surgery boasts a remarkable scope of correction that extends beyond what LASIK and PRK address. RLE is a versatile option capable of correcting a wide range of refractive errors, including presbyopia, a common age-related condition that affects near vision. Presbyopia typically becomes more noticeable after age 40, making RLE an ideal choice for individuals seeking not only to correct nearsightedness or farsightedness but also to address age-related changes in vision. Unlike LASIK and PRK, which focus primarily on myopia, hyperopia, and astigmatism, lens replacement surgery offers a comprehensive solution for individuals with multifaceted vision issues.

  2. Age Considerations
    Age plays a crucial role in determining the most suitable vision correction procedure. LASIK and PRK are generally recommended for younger individuals who may not yet have developed age-related vision changes. However, as we age, the likelihood of developing conditions like presbyopia increases. Lens replacement surgery is advantageous for those over 40, especially those experiencing age-related vision alterations. RLE addresses common refractive errors and provides a solution for presbyopia, making it an attractive option for individuals seeking a long-term vision correction strategy.

  3. Procedure Approach
    The approach of each procedure distinguishes lens replacement surgery from LASIK and PRK. LASIK and PRK focus on reshaping the cornea to alter how light enters the eye. In contrast, lens replacement surgery takes a more comprehensive approach by entirely replacing the eye's natural lens. This distinction is pivotal in understanding how each procedure achieves vision correction. The choice between these procedures depends on various factors, including eye health, age, and the desired outcome. Individuals seeking a solution for presbyopia or those with significant refractive errors may find lens replacement surgery the most effective and lasting option.
